CMC Vellore PG Courses: Admission Process and Fees

Admission to CMC Vellore‘s MD and MS programmes runs through NEET-PG, the same national exam used for most PG medical seats across India. Once you clear the required merit cutoff, CMC conducts its own selection process for its PG seats, which fall outside standard MCC/state counselling since CMC is a private, Christian-community-run institution affiliated with Tamil Nadu Dr. M.G.R. Medical University.

Total course fees for CMC Vellore’s 3-year MD/MS programmes run around ₹6.6 lakh, and a mandatory service bond applies to admitted students, a distinctive feature not found at centrally-funded institutions like AIIMS.

AIIMS Delhi PG Courses: Admission Process and Fees

This is the detail that trips up a lot of aspirants: AIIMS Delhi PG courses (MD, MS, MDS) do not accept NEET-PG at all. Admission runs entirely through INI-CET (Institute of National Importance Combined Entrance Test), a separate exam conducted specifically for AIIMS, JIPMER, PGIMER, and NIMHANS campuses, followed by AIIMS’s own counselling process.

Fees are nominal, since AIIMS is a centrally funded government institution, total PG course fees run around ₹7,577 for the full 3-year programme. There’s no service bond attached to AIIMS Delhi PG admission.

AIIMS Delhi vs CMC Vellore MBBS: A Quick Note Before PG

Since many readers researching PG options also compare undergraduate paths, it’s worth a quick mention: AIIMS Delhi vs CMC Vellore MBBS admission both run through NEET-UG, unlike the PG stage where the exams diverge completely. AIIMS Delhi’s MBBS fees are similarly nominal, while CMC Vellore’s MBBS carries a moderate annual fee alongside its own service bond structure.

AIIMS Delhi vs CMC Vellore PG: Full Comparison Table

Here’s AIIMS Delhi vs CMC Vellore PG laid out side by side:

Factor CMC Vellore AIIMS Delhi
Entrance Exam NEET-PG INI-CET
Institution Type Private, Christian-community run Centrally funded, Institute of National Importance
Total PG Course Fee (approx.) ₹6.6 Lakh ₹7,577
Service Bond Mandatory None
NIRF Medical Ranking 3rd 1st
PG Median Placement Package Approx. ₹7.95 LPA (2-year PG) Approx. ₹18-40 LPA (varies by course/year)

AIIMS Delhi vs CMC Vellore Fees: The Real Cost Difference

The gap in AIIMS Delhi vs CMC Vellore fees is stark: AIIMS Delhi’s PG fee is close to symbolic, a reflection of full government funding, while CMC Vellore’s roughly ₹6.6 lakh total is still modest compared to many private deemed universities, but meaningfully higher than a central government institute. Factor in CMC’s mandatory service bond too, since that carries its own financial and time commitment beyond tuition.

AIIMS Delhi vs CMC Vellore Ranking

On AIIMS Delhi vs CMC Vellore ranking, NIRF’s most recent medical rankings place AIIMS Delhi 1st nationally and CMC Vellore 3rd, both are consistently ranked among India’s top handful of medical institutions, so neither is a compromise pick by any reasonable standard.

AIIMS Delhi vs CMC Vellore Comparison: Bond, Stipend, and Placement

Beyond fees and rank, a few other factors matter for this AIIMS Delhi vs CMC Vellore comparison:

  • Service bond: CMC Vellore’s mandatory bond typically requires a period of service at CMC-affiliated rural or mission hospitals post-training, AIIMS Delhi carries no such obligation.
  • Research infrastructure: AIIMS Delhi, as a national government institute, generally offers deeper access to large-scale clinical research and funding.
  • Clinical exposure and mission ethos: CMC Vellore is widely known for strong clinical training with a service-oriented, mission-hospital network, particularly valuable if community and rural healthcare work interests you long-term.
  • Location and language: CMC is in Tamil Nadu; AIIMS is in Delhi, a genuinely practical factor depending on where you’re comfortable settling for 3+ years.

AIIMS Delhi vs CMC Vellore Which Is Better?

Honestly, AIIMS Delhi vs CMC Vellore which is better doesn’t have a single universal answer, it depends on what you’re optimising for. If pure ranking, research access, and zero financial or bond commitment matter most, AIIMS Delhi is hard to beat. If you value CMC’s distinctive clinical training culture, mission-hospital network, and are comfortable with a service bond, CMC Vellore is an excellent, genuinely competitive choice in its own right.

The bigger practical reality: since AIIMS vs CMC Vellore means preparing for two entirely different entrance exams, most candidates end up choosing one preparation track as their primary focus rather than treating both as interchangeable targets.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q1. Does CMC Vellore accept NEET-PG for its PG courses?
Yes, CMC Vellore’s MD/MS admissions are based on NEET-PG scores, followed by CMC’s own selection process.

Q2. Does AIIMS Delhi accept NEET-PG for its PG courses?
No, AIIMS Delhi PG courses (MD/MS/MDS) admit exclusively through INI-CET, a separate entrance exam.

Q3. Which has higher fees, CMC Vellore or AIIMS Delhi PG courses?
CMC Vellore, at approximately ₹6.6 lakh for the full 3-year MD/MS programme, compared to AIIMS Delhi’s nominal government-subsidised fee of around ₹7,577.

Q4. Does CMC Vellore have a service bond for PG students?
Yes, CMC Vellore requires a mandatory service bond for admitted students. AIIMS Delhi has no such bond requirement.

Q5. Is AIIMS Delhi ranked higher than CMC Vellore?
Per recent NIRF rankings, yes, AIIMS Delhi is ranked 1st nationally in Medical, with CMC Vellore ranked 3rd. Both remain among India’s top medical institutions.
